Hello! I have been using Noscript for a couple of years now and I am really pleased with what it does. I install it on every machine I own and find it extremely useful.

Recently I tried installing it on a laptop which was owned by a friend and had a different language setup. So I installed it on firefox and it was installed on that language. I then uninstalled (cause I could not locate the language setup) and changed ALL computer settings I could find to english (through control panel regional settings - my location settings, etc etc) and tried reinstalling the addon. My mozilla is in english but for some weird reason the addon again installs in foreign language.

Any ideas on how to correct this?

Please double check that your general.useragent.locale about:config preference is set to "en-US".

That is correct Giorgio :) I changed the value to en-us and then had no-script reinstalled. Its in english now, thank you very much.
